What types of accommodation are available near major sports venues?
Sports venue accommodation options include luxury hotels, mid-range properties, budget hostels, holiday rentals, and corporate lodging facilities. Each category offers distinct advantages depending on your group size, budget, and specific requirements for accommodation near sporting events.
Luxury hotels near stadiums typically provide premium amenities such as concierge services, fine dining, spa facilities, and executive lounges. These properties often offer shuttle services to venues and cater specifically to VIP guests and corporate groups attending major tournaments. Mid-range hotels balance comfort with affordability, featuring standard amenities such as fitness centres, restaurants, and business facilities whilst maintaining convenient proximity to the venue.
Budget hostels and guesthouses serve cost-conscious travellers, particularly younger sports fans or large groups seeking basic accommodation. Holiday rentals through online platforms offer entire properties, making them ideal for families or corporate teams that need kitchen facilities and multiple bedrooms. Corporate lodging provides extended-stay options with apartment-style amenities, ideal for tournament staff or media crews who require longer-term sports travel accommodation.
Each accommodation type suits different traveller profiles, from individual fans seeking budget options to corporate groups requiring full-service amenities and dedicated event support.
How far in advance should you book accommodation for major sporting events?
Major sporting events typically require booking 6–12 months in advance, whilst smaller tournaments may need 2–3 months of advance planning. Championship events, the Olympics, and World Cup matches often sell out accommodation within days of fixture announcements, making immediate booking essential.
Formula 1 races, UEFA Championships, and Wimbledon create massive accommodation demand, with hotels near venues often fully booked up to 18 months in advance. Corporate groups and hospitality packages frequently secure blocks of rooms years ahead, limiting availability for individual bookings.
Regional tournaments and league matches typically require booking 1–3 months in advance, depending on team popularity and venue capacity. Weekend fixtures generate higher demand than midweek events, affecting both availability and pricing for tournament hotels.
Booking strategies include monitoring fixture releases, setting price alerts, and considering alternative accommodation types when preferred options are unavailable. Flexible dates and a willingness to stay farther from venues can provide more options, though transportation costs and travel time must be factored into decisions.
What are the key factors to consider when choosing sports venue accommodation?
Critical factors include proximity to the venue, transport links, pricing, available amenities, group booking options, and cancellation policies. These elements significantly affect your overall sports event experience and total travel costs.
Distance from the venue affects both convenience and cost. Properties within walking distance eliminate transport concerns but command premium rates. Properties within 5–10 kilometres often provide better value whilst maintaining reasonable access via public transport or shuttle services.
Transport infrastructure matters enormously. Hotels near metro stations, bus routes, or official shuttle services offer superior connectivity. Parking availability becomes crucial for visitors who are driving, though city-centre venues often discourage car travel during major events.
Amenities should match your needs and group size. Business travellers might prioritise Wi-Fi, meeting rooms, and concierge services. Families often need connecting rooms, restaurants, and recreational facilities. Group bookings require consideration of rooming lists, payment terms, and dedicated check-in processes.
Cancellation policies become vital given fixture changes, weather concerns, or travel disruptions that are common at sporting events. Flexible booking terms provide peace of mind, though they often carry premium pricing compared to non-refundable rates.
How does accommodation pricing change during major sporting events?
Accommodation pricing increases dramatically during major sporting events, often rising 200–500% above standard rates. Dynamic pricing models adjust costs based on demand, with prices fluctuating daily as events approach and availability decreases.
Championship events create the most significant price surges. Hotels near Wembley during FA Cup finals or properties around Monaco during Formula 1 weekend command extraordinary premiums. Even budget accommodation sees substantial increases, with hostel beds costing more than typical hotel rooms during peak events.
Seasonal factors compound event pricing. Summer tournaments that coincide with holiday periods create double demand pressure. Winter indoor events may offer more reasonable accommodation costs, though popular destinations still see significant increases.
Minimum-stay requirements often accompany major events, forcing visitors to book multiple nights even for single-day competitions. Weekend events typically carry higher premiums than midweek fixtures, though this varies by sport and audience demographics.
Booking strategies for managing costs include reserving early, considering alternative dates, exploring accommodation farther from venues, and investigating package deals that bundle lodging with tickets or transport.
What transportation options connect accommodation to sports venues?
Transportation options include public transport systems, official shuttle services, walking routes, ride-sharing platforms, private transfers, and parking facilities. The best choice depends on venue location, group size, budget, and the quality of local infrastructure.
Public transport often provides the most efficient access during major events. Metro systems, dedicated bus services, and rail connections typically increase frequency during sporting events. Many cities offer special event transport passes that cover multiple journey types and provide better value than individual tickets.
Official shuttle services operate from designated hotels and transport hubs, offering guaranteed capacity and reliable timing. These services often include return transport and eliminate parking concerns, though they may involve additional costs and fixed departure times.
Walking remains popular for nearby accommodation, typically within 1–2 kilometres of venues. Pedestrian routes often receive special management during events, with dedicated pathways and a security presence ensuring safe passage.
Ride-sharing and taxi services provide flexibility but face surge pricing and availability challenges during peak times. Pre-booking private transfers offers reliability for groups or premium travellers, though costs significantly exceed public transport options.
